See the License for the specific language governing permissions and limitations under the License. */ package e2e_test import ( "fmt" "os" "os/exec" "path/filepath" "strings" "time" . "github.com/onsi/ginkgo" . "github.com/onsi/gomega" "github.com/qiniu/goc/pkg/build" ) var TESTS_ROOT string var _ = BeforeSuite(func() { TESTS_ROOT, _ = os.Getwd() By("Current working directory: " + TESTS_ROOT) TESTS_ROOT = filepath.Join(TESTS_ROOT, "..") }) var _ = Describe("E2E", func() { var GOPATH string BeforeEach(func() { GOPATH = os.Getenv("GOPATH") // in GitHub Action, this value is empty if GOPATH == "" { GOPATH = filepath.Join(os.Getenv("HOME"), "go") } }) Context("Go module", func() { It("Simple project", func() { startTime := time.Now() By("goc build") testProjDir := filepath.Join(TESTS_ROOT, "samples/simple_project") cmd := exec.Command("goc", "build", "--debug") cmd.Dir = testProjDir cmd.Env = append(os.Environ(), "GO111MODULE=on") out, err := cmd.CombinedOutput() Expect(err).To(BeNil(), "goc build on this project should be successful", string(out)) By("goc install") testProjDir = filepath.Join(TESTS_ROOT, "samples/simple_project") cmd = exec.Command("goc", "install", "--debug") cmd.Dir = testProjDir out, err = cmd.CombinedOutput() Expect(err).To(BeNil(), "goc install on this project should be successful", string(out)) By("check files in generated temporary directory") tempDir := filepath.Join(os.TempDir(), build.TmpFolderName(testProjDir)) _, err = os.Lstat(tempDir) Expect(err).To(BeNil(), "projects should be copied to temporary directory") By("check if cover variables are injected") _, err = os.Lstat(filepath.Join(tempDir, "http_cover_apis_auto_generated.go")) Expect(err).To(BeNil(), "a http server file should be generated") By("check generated binary") objects := []string{GOPATH + "/bin", testProjDir} for _, dir := range objects { obj := filepath.Join(dir, "simple-project") fInfo, err := os.Lstat(obj) Expect(err).To(BeNil()) Expect(startTime.Before(fInfo.ModTime())).To(Equal(true), obj+"new binary should be generated, not the old one") cmd := exec.Command("go", "tool", "objdump", "simple-project") cmd.Dir = dir out, err = cmd.CombinedOutput() Expect(err).To(BeNil(), "the binary cannot be disassembled") cnt := strings.Count(string(out), "GoCover") Expect(cnt).To(BeNumerically(">", 0), "GoCover varibale should be in the binary") cnt = strings.Count(string(out), "main.registerSelf") Expect(cnt).To(BeNumerically(">", 0), "main.registerSelf function should be in the binary") } }) }) Context("GOPATH", func() { var GOPATH string BeforeEach(func() { GOPATH = os.Getenv("GOPATH") }) It("Simple GOPATH project", func() { startTime := time.Now() testProjDir := filepath.Join(TESTS_ROOT, "samples/simple_gopath_project") oriWorkingDir := filepath.Join(testProjDir, "src/qiniu.com/simple_gopath_project") GOPATH = testProjDir By("goc build") cmd := exec.Command("goc", "build", "--debug") cmd.Dir = oriWorkingDir // use GOPATH mode to compile project cmd.Env = append(os.Environ(), fmt.Sprintf("GOPATH=%v", GOPATH), "GO111MODULE=off") out, err := cmd.CombinedOutput() fmt.Println(string(out)) Expect(err).To(BeNil(), "goc build on this project should be successful", string(out), cmd.Dir) By("goc install") testProjDir = filepath.Join(TESTS_ROOT, "samples/simple_gopath_project") cmd = exec.Command("goc", "install", "--debug") cmd.Dir = filepath.Join(testProjDir, "src/qiniu.com/simple_gopath_project") // use GOPATH mode to compile project cmd.Env = append(os.Environ(), fmt.Sprintf("GOPATH=%v", testProjDir), "GO111MODULE=off") out, err = cmd.CombinedOutput() Expect(err).To(BeNil(), "goc install on this project should be successful", string(out)) By("check files in generated temporary directory") tempDir := filepath.Join(os.TempDir(), build.TmpFolderName(oriWorkingDir)) _, err = os.Lstat(tempDir) Expect(err).To(BeNil(), "projects should be copied to temporary directory") By("check if cover variables are injected") newWorkingDir := filepath.Join(tempDir, "src/qiniu.com/simple_gopath_project") _, err = os.Lstat(filepath.Join(newWorkingDir, "http_cover_apis_auto_generated.go")) Expect(err).To(BeNil(), "a http server file should be generated") By("check generated binary") objects := []string{GOPATH + "/bin", oriWorkingDir} for _, dir := range objects { obj := filepath.Join(dir, "simple_gopath_project") fInfo, err := os.Lstat(obj) Expect(err).To(BeNil()) Expect(startTime.Before(fInfo.ModTime())).To(Equal(true), "new binary should be generated, not the old one") cmd := exec.Command("go", "tool", "objdump", "simple_gopath_project") cmd.Dir = dir out, err = cmd.CombinedOutput() Expect(err).To(BeNil(), "the binary cannot be disassembled") cnt := strings.Count(string(out), "GoCover") Expect(cnt).To(BeNumerically(">", 0), "GoCover variable should be in the binary") cnt = strings.Count(string(out), "main.registerSelf") Expect(cnt).To(BeNumerically(">", 0), "main.registerSelf function should be in the binary") } }) }) })
